High pressure still covers most of New Zealand but it’s now starting to slide away to the east.
For this time of year, warmer than usual weather is moving in. Clouds also thicken in the west.
Drill down for more details with your hourly, local, weather forecast, as rain is moving in (along with gales) in the days ahead for some regions.
